inspect-openreward

PyPI version Python

Run OpenReward environments as Inspect evals.

Provides an Inspect-native Dataset, Scorer, and a session-lifecycle wrapper solver for any OpenReward environment, so you get Inspect's eval harness, transcript viewer, metrics, and model abstraction for free — and OpenReward's tools, tasks, and rewards surface as first-class Inspect primitives. The wrapper takes an arbitrary inner solver chain, so you can keep the default react-style loop or plug in your own scaffolding (system_message, basic_agent, react, custom @solver, …) without touching session management.

Custom solver chains

openreward_solver is a wrapper: it owns session open/close, prompt injection, tool conversion + installation, and reward capture, and then runs whatever inner solver chain you hand it. That means any Inspect solver composition slots in — chain together system_message, prompt_template, chain_of_thought, self_critique, use_tools(..., append=True), basic_agent, react, or your own @solver — and the OpenReward session-bound tools remain available throughout:

from inspect_ai.solver import chain, generate, system_message

@task
def terminal_bench_2_verified_custom() -> Task:
    env = OpenReward().environments.get(name="GeneralReasoning/terminal-bench-2-verified")
    return Task(
        dataset=openreward_dataset(env, split="test", limit=10),
        solver=openreward_solver(
            env,
            chain(
                system_message("Think carefully before each tool call."),
                generate(tool_calls="loop"),
            ),
            toolset="claude-code"
        ),
        scorer=openreward_scorer(),
    )

Reward / finished capture is baked into the installed tools, so it keeps working no matter how the inner chain drives tool calls (generate(...), execute_tools(...) inside basic_agent, a custom loop, …).

What each piece does

openreward_dataset(environment, split, limit=None, shuffle=False, seed=None)

Builds an Inspect Dataset from an OpenReward environment split. Each Sample carries the underlying OpenReward Task in metadata; the prompt is resolved lazily by the solver (so image prompts work, and there's no network round-trip at dataset-construction time).

openreward_solver(environment, solver=None, *, toolset=None, tool_choice="auto")

Session-lifecycle wrapper around an arbitrary inner solver chain. Per sample it:

  1. Opens environment.session(task=..., toolset=toolset).
  2. Fetches session.get_prompt() and injects it as the user message (text and image blocks both supported).
  3. Converts session.list_tools() into Inspect tools, auto-detecting the provider from state.model.api and sanitising the JSON schema via openreward.sanitize_tool_schema, and installs them on state.tools / state.tool_choice.
  4. Runs the inner solver inside the open session. If solver=None (the default), runs generate(tool_calls="loop") — the react-style loop. Pass a Solver or a list[Solver] (composed via chain(...)) to customise.
  5. Captures the terminal reward / finished from tool outputs into state.metadata for the scorer to read — regardless of how the inner chain invokes tools.
  6. Closes the session on teardown.

Arguments

  • environment: the OpenReward Environment to open sessions against. The dataset should be built from the same environment.
  • solver: inner solver (or list[Solver], normalised via inspect_ai.solver.chain). Defaults to generate(tool_calls="loop").
  • toolset (keyword-only): optional OpenReward toolset name passed to environment.session(...) — e.g. "claude-code" for a harness-native bash tool surface in addition to the environment's own tools.
  • tool_choice (keyword-only): passed through to Inspect's state.tool_choice.

Inner chains can layer on further tools via use_tools(extra_tools, append=True) — the session-bound tools installed by the wrapper remain available.

openreward_scorer()

@scorer that reads the terminal reward captured by openreward_solver and returns an Inspect Score. Metrics: mean() and stderr(). Samples that never produced a reward (e.g. ran out of turns) score 0.0.

openreward_tool_to_inspect(tool_spec, session, provider=None)

Low-level helper for converting a single OpenReward ToolSpec into an Inspect Tool. The openreward_solver wrapper is built on top of this; use it directly if you want to bypass the wrapper and manage the session yourself.

Model provider mapping

The solver maps Inspect's model-provider identifier to OpenReward's Provider enum for schema sanitisation:

Inspect state.model.api OpenReward provider
openai, openai-api openai
anthropic anthropic
google, vertex google
openrouter openrouter
anything else openai (safest superset)
